When comparing available office suites, many users end up considering two prominent free options: WPS Office and LibreOffice. Both applications include comprehensive tools for writing, calculating, and presenting, yet they tackle these capabilities using markedly separate design philosophies and operational frameworks. Grasping these variations assists in picking the software that optimally suits your productivity habits, design sensibilities, and feature demands.
WPS Office originates from Kingsoft, a Chinese software company that began creating this productivity package in the late 1980s. Its interface immediately feels familiar The ribbon interface, chromatic organization, and sleek visuals produce an environment that shortens the onboarding process for migrating users. This careful emulation of Office's visual style serves as a strategic choice to capture users seeking an alternative without sacrificing familiarity. The suite maintains this consistency across its three core applications: its document editor, data processor, and slide creator.
LibreOffice, conversely, arose out of the open-source community after splitting from OpenOffice.org in 2010. The Document Foundation oversees The Document Foundation, a nonprofit organization dedicated to open-source ideals. Conventionally, the UI featured drop-down menus and button bars rather than tabbed ribbons, though modern iterations provide tabbed alternatives. This origin story imbues LibreOffice with a unique interface style, one that values feature richness above aesthetic polish. Users often describe the experience as more utilitarian, with every feature obtainable through extensive menu trees instead of visible shortcuts.
Document format support constitutes WPS Office demonstrates excellent fidelity when opening Microsoft Office documents, chiefly because it aims to mirror Microsoft's rendering capabilities. Detailed styling, inserted objects, and advanced formatting mostly migrate with minimal disruption. Nevertheless, this benefit involves a limitation: WPS uses proprietary formats by default, and its long-term document preservation hinges on the developer's survival and continued compatibility. LibreOffice embraces open document standards, standardizing on ODF yet offering extensive Microsoft format compatibility through technical reconstruction. This adherence to openness secures that documents remain accessible independent of company choices.
The capabilities differ in notable respects WPS Office includes native cloud services, PDF creation utilities, and smartphone applications that harmonize with desktop editions. These amenities draw in users who appreciate unified experiences spanning phones and computers. The software further includes a substantial template library, delivering expertly crafted document designs requiring few adjustments. LibreOffice compensates with deeper functionality in certain areas, specifically its Base database tool and Math equation editor, features completely absent from WPS. Advanced users frequently value LibreOffice's macro support, coding possibilities, and expansion through user-created add-ons.
Speed and resource usage vary significantly between them WPS Office generally launches faster and consumes fewer system resources during typical use, enabling smooth operation on dated equipment or contexts where speed is critical.
